Sound waves entering an area of warmer air

Respuesta :

akatigger27
akatigger27 akatigger27
  • 04-01-2021

Answer: Sound waves entering a warmer air means that the kinetic energy of the air particles will increase and thus the vibration of particles will be increased and thus the speed of transmission of sound waves increases.
